Mathias Kresin 8424b9bfb1 add brackets to unread, page and feed items counter via CSS
Unified the page-counters before.

This makes processing of counters in javascript way more easier. The minimum
required browser versions for the needed CSS3 selectors are IE9, Firefox 3.5
and Chrome 5. Confirmed working with IE9, Firefox 24.6, Chrome 36, Mobile Safari
on iOS6.

An unintended side effect of CSS brackets is that theme designers are able to
implement there idea of brackets.

Miniflux - Minimalist News Reader

Miniflux is a minimalist and web-based RSS reader.

Features

Host almost anywhere

  • Your Raspberry Pi, a shared web-hosting, a virtual machine or localhost
  • Easy setup => copy and paste the source code and you are done!
  • Use a lightweight Sqlite database instead of Mysql or Postgresql

Readability

  • CSS optimized for readability
  • Responsive design

Privacy and security

  • Remove Feedburner Ads and analytics trackers (1x1 pixels)
  • Open external links inside a new tab with a rel="noreferrer" attribute
  • Use secure HTTP headers (only external images and Youtube/Vimeo/Dailymotion videos are allowed)
  • Article content is filtered before being displayed

Polyglot

  • Translated in English, French, German, Italian, Czech, Spanish, Portuguese and Simplified Chinese
  • RTL languages support

Awesome features

  • Keyboard shortcuts
  • Full article download for feeds that display only a summary
  • Enclosure support (videos and podcasts)
  • Feed updates via a cronjob or with the user interface with one click

More

  • Keeps history of read items
  • Basic bookmarks
  • Import/Export of OPML feeds
  • Themes
  • Auto-update from the user interface
  • Multiple databases (each user has his own database)

Requirements

  • Recent version of libxml2 >= 2.7.x (version 2.6.32 on Debian Lenny is not supported anymore)
  • PHP >= 5.3.3
  • PHP XML extensions (SimpleXML and DOM)
  • PHP Sqlite extension
  • cURL extension for PHP or Stream Context with allow_url_fopen=On
